Chapter 5 Quadriceps
Quadriceps are the muscles in front of your thighs. Many people who run, bike, or play sports develop large and strong quadriceps.

Thighs = The thighs contain several muscles. The quadriceps and hamstrings help us bend and extend the hips and knees. The abductors move the legs inward / toward each other. The pectineus and sartorius let you flex and rotate the thighs at the hip joints.
